“419” is a confidence trick known as ‘Advanced Fee Fraud’. The victim is asked to join a business venture to provide capital for a scheme that will make money fast. They are thenn asked for more and more money and once they finally realize they have been scammed, the criminals have absconded with their money.

As the investment is illicit, the victim cannot go to the police; the perperators are then free to carry on with their scam.

The 419 Code is the incredible true story of Baaba, one of the first to run the scam, and coin the name. From his quiet upbringing in a small village in Nigeria, he masterminded one of the biggest cash scams to hit the modern world.
